Efflatounaria

Efflatounaria is a genus of soft corals in the family Xeniidae.

Species

The World Register of Marine Species lists the following species:[1]

  • Efflatounaria alba Verseveldt, 1977
  • Efflatounaria nana Hickson, 1931
  • Efflatounaria tottoni Gohar, 1939
